Systemic Corticosteroids Avoidance Study in Severe Asthma Patients

Stopped early · Phase 3 · Has a placebo group

Conditions studied: Asthma

In brief

The overall purpose of this study was to determine the efficacy of fevipiprant (150 mg and 450 mg once daily), compared with placebo, as add-on to standard-of-care asthma therapy, in terms of avoidance of corticosteroid use over 52 weeks.
